Output dd6397307ef321a80b719832b53757fc6f890cdbb76f323da54f62255b8f78e2:0

value
18110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ce0c50f1f7523c142e58a92670cd59db238076ba OP_EQUAL
address
3LUVsodmbYhuyB1moAEpbVa2JntowhjrWm
transaction
dd6397307ef321a80b719832b53757fc6f890cdbb76f323da54f62255b8f78e2
spent
true